Going out after work Friday. Was thinking about hitting the Middle Channel. Sounds like this is a decent place right now. When back trolling the channel with crawler harnesses (per Cory's fishing report), should I use bottom bouncers or another method? Also, any particular area of the MIddle Channel hitting better than others? My hot spots map says the stretch of channel just before it joins up with the north channel is a good spot.

A hot spot would be on the east side as it flows into the lake 3/4 of a mile along that side. There's a boat club right there. Alot of boats are docked there you can't miss it.

I may have misunderstood Cory's report, but I think he meant people were only backtrolling in the North Channel. I thought this was to try and stay vertical. In the middle they were trolling normal as they are by metro. I believe everything in the Middle Channel is the same as metro, except the depth. Just thought I'd mention it.
